Ice Regelation

by STEAM3D

Description

This model demonstrates a classic experiment where a weight-loaded wire sling passes through a block of ice without cutting it apart, as the plane of separation refreezes. This phenomenon is known as the regelation of ice. The common explanation for this is largely based on the unique properties of water, specifically the decrease in melting temperature with increased pressure. However a significant aspect of the explanation is the role of heat conduction. When the experiment is repeated using wire with lower heat conductivity (such as nylon), the regelation effect disappears.
